Samuel Adams, Founding Father

Sunday September 27, 2009

September 27 marks the birthday of Samuel Adams. Adams was an American colonial revolutionary who participated in organizing the Boston Tea Party. This was a significant event that took place during the American Revolutionary War. He is considered to be one of the top ten founding fathers.
